How to get to Tanjung Sepat? It is kind of simple. Followed the map above, we followed Sg Pelek road, and we saw the sign board of Bagan Lalang, we supposed to turn right, but we don't turn in. We go straight all the way, around 20 minutes and Tanjung Sepat signboard will be on the left side.

So, what is it so special about Tanjung Sepat? Ok, first we visited Joo Ha Coffee Trading. It is located at Lorong 5. This is not really a shop, the boss fully utilized his left over space beside his house to make coffee. He fries the coffee bean, and make the coffee powder. What is the famous in Lorong 4? They are very famous of bun. Hai Yew Heng, basically already sell off their bun very early, and you have to reserve buns if you would like to taste. We bought few buns, as compared to others who ordered 30, 50, 100 buns per day, we are really the most valueless customer for them. I had tried Mei Cai Bun and Sheng Rou bun. Mei Cai Bun was quite special for me, first time tasted mei cai in a bun. The taste is acceptable, it will be the best served with some chili sauce. Sheng Rou bun was not bad too. The texture of the bun is soft, and normally they take buns with a cup of coffee.

Later on, we proceed to mushroom's farm. Agotech is the name of the company. They combined a homestay service for visitors, a mini market for their product, and a farm beside the shop. They grow numerous types of mushroom, I think around 5-7 types. The most special 1 will be ling zhi. First time visited mushroom farm, and got to know the way how mushroom is grow.
